Do I believe what this woman said about my husband?

Tagged as: Marriage problems<< Previous question   Next question >>
Question - (26 March 2010) 4 Answers - (Newest, 26 March 2010)
A female United States age 41-50, *ookiemon77 writes:

Last night I got a facebook message from a woman that is my husbands ex-wifes friend. I had requested to be friends because I remember her from my hometown and she was a friend incommon with someone else. But it turns out that was a bad decision because she thought that I had sent her a request because she is my husbands ex-wifes friend. And she started telling me a bunch of bad things about him. About how his ex-wife left him because he was unfaithful and mentioned a whole bunch of womans names one of them I recognize. She said that he wasn't worth anything and went on and on about this. My question is what do I believe?
